According to 6Wresearch internal database and industry insights, the Global Poultry Intestinal Health Market was valued at USD 0.95 Billion in 2024 and is expected to reach USD 1.7 Billion by 2031, growing at a compound annual growth rate of 8.70% during the forecast period (2025-2031).

The Global Poultry Intestinal Health Market faces several challenges, including the increasing regulations on the use of antibiotics in poultry production, which has led to the need for alternative solutions to maintain intestinal health. Additionally, the rising consumer demand for antibiotic-free and organic poultry products has put pressure on producers to find effective yet sustainable ways to manage intestinal health without the use of antibiotics. Furthermore, the prevalence of diseases such as coccidiosis and necrotic enteritis continues to pose a significant threat to poultry intestinal health, requiring innovative strategies for prevention and treatment. Market players in the poultry intestinal health sector must navigate these challenges by investing in research and development to offer safe, effective, and sustainable solutions that meet both regulatory requirements and consumer preferences.

Government policies related to the Global Poultry Intestinal Health Market primarily focus on ensuring food safety, animal welfare, and disease prevention. Regulatory bodies such as the USDA and the European Food Safety Authority set standards for the use of antibiotics, probiotics, and other feed additives to maintain intestinal health in poultry. Governments also implement biosecurity measures to prevent the spread of diseases like Salmonella and Avian Influenza, which can impact poultry intestinal health. Additionally, some regions have stringent regulations on the use of growth-promoting antibiotics in poultry feed to address concerns about antimicrobial resistance. Overall, government policies in the Global Poultry Intestinal Health Market aim to promote the well-being of poultry, protect consumer health, and support sustainable farming practices.
